Mehari Mezekerta (Mez), from Eritrea and currently pursuing an International MBA at Renmin University of China, shared her profound experiences during her first visit to Xinjiang. She was not only amazed by the vastness of the region but also deeply impressed by the harmonious coexistence of cultural diversity, technological advancement, and ancient traditions.

During her trip, Mez witnessed how Xinjiang preserves its rich cultural heritage, such as literature, dance, languages, and religious practices, while also achieving remarkable progress in fields like new energy and modern agriculture. The rural libraries and eco-friendly sustainable development practices further revealed to her the foresight embedded in this land.

Mez summarized her journey with three keywords: diversity, harmony, and hospitality. As someone who has experienced Xinjiang firsthand, she extends a sincere invitation to the world: don't hesitate, Xinjiang is truly worth exploring and discovering for yourself.
